Delegate groups meet to submit proposals to NCC Work Committee

YANGON, 25 Feb — The meetings to seek approval for the proposals of delegate groups concerning the NCC Work Committee chairman’s clarification on 22 February on detailed basic principles for distribution of the legislative power to be included in the framing of the State Constitution to be submitted to the National Convention Convening Work Committee were held at the meeting halls of Nyaunghnapin Camp in Hmawby Township today.

Delegates of Political Parties

The Delegates of Political Parties held a meeting to compile the proposal to be submitted to the NCC Work Committee at the meeting hall No 1 at 10 am today. The master of ceremonies announced the validity of the meeting as 28 delegates out of 29 attended the meeting, accounting for 96.55 per cent. Member of the Panel of Alternate Chairmen U Saw Philip (a) U Philip Sam of Wa National Development Party, presiding over the meeting, gave an opening address.

U Tun Yi of National Unity Party read out the proposal of Delegates of Political Parties concerning the NCC Work Committee chairman’s clarification to detailed basic principles for distribution of the legislative power to be included in the framing of the State Constitution.

The meeting approved the proposal of the Delegates of Political Parties to be submitted to the NCC Work Committee. Later, the meeting ended with concluding remarks by the alternate chairman.

Delegates of National Races

The meeting of the Delegates of National Races was held at the Pyidaungsu Hall at 2 pm. Duwa Zok Daung of Shan State (North) presided over the meeting together with members of the Panel of Chairmen U Mahn Ohn Maung of Kayin State and U Kyaw Din (a) U Thay Yai of Kayah State.

The master of ceremonies announced the validity of the meeting as 608 delegates out of 633 attended the meeting, accounting for 96.05 per cent.

Member of the Panel of Alternate Chairmen Duwa Zok Daung gave a speech. Next, U Aung Zan Wai of Rakhine State read the proposal regarding the NCC Work Committee chairman’s clarification on detailed basic principles for distribution of the legislative power to be included in the framing of the State Constitution.

The meeting approved the proposal to be submitted to the NCC Work Committee. Afterwards, the member of the Alternate Chairmen gave concluding remarks.
